The best thing to do is take your car up there for a few day’s and go and see some of the big transport companies,and make enquiries about jobs,pay and conditions etc.

Like the rest of europe,Sweden has seen a huge influx of east european driver’s and transport companies,from the Baltic states in particular,that are undercutting the Swede’s.

It depends on what kind of work you’re looking for,if it’s regulat trips to the UK then you’ll be disappointed,if it’s euro work,then you may have better luck.

Nils Hansson Ã…keri told all their Swedish driver’s that they were going to be replaced by German’s over a year ago.However,out of the 49 jobs they advertised to German driver’s,they only managed to fill 9 places!
If you don’t mind tramping up and down to Spain,then it might be worth going to see them.
They have very well equipped kit.

A lot of the trucks you see pulling for Swedish companies may be in the company livery,but are subbies from smaller companies.
